RAX-3000吸附剂生产优化
Production optimization of RAX-3000 adsorbent

【摘要】 2011年4月石油化工科学研究院研发的RAX-3000型对二甲苯吸附剂在催化剂长岭分公司成功完成工业试生产,RAX-3000工业试验剂在扬子石化对二甲苯吸附分离工业示范装置的首次工业应用,实现开车投料一次成功,并顺利通过吸附剂性能考核标定。在海南炼化RAX-3000吸附剂生产过程中,对吸附剂焙烧、预湿、碱处理以及交换等生产工序进行了优化,共生产RAX-3000型对二甲苯吸附剂成品1.2 kt。物化指标分析及小型模拟移动床评价结果表明,RAX-3000型对二甲苯吸附剂各项物化指标合格;以工业装置混合二甲苯为原料,在110%负荷原料流量下获得的对二甲苯纯度≥99.8%,对二甲苯收率≥97%。
【Abstract】 The trail production of RAX-3000 PX adsorbent that developed by Sinopec Research Institute of Petroleum Processing(RIPP) was successfully completed by Sinopec Catalyst Company Changling Division.This batch of RAX-3000 PX adsorbent was first applied on the industrial PX demonstration unit in Sinopec Yangzi Petrochemical Company and achieved success in the first trial of start-up,performing good at calibration assessment.The techniques of calcination,pre-wet,alkali treatment and ion exchange were optimized during the production of 1200 t RAX-3000 PX adsorbent which would be applied on Sinopec Hainan Refining & Chemical Company.The analysis result of physicochemical index and the evaluation result of adsorption and separation showed that all the 1200 t adsorbent was qualified.The evaluation result for this batch of adsorbent in small-scale simulated moving bed showed that using the mixed xylenes from industrial unit as feed,under the load of 110%,PX average purity reached 99.8% with an average yield of 97%.
